james_desantis 's review for:
Invincible Iron Man, Volume 1: Reboot
by Brian Michael Bendis
Well...this was fun. Yeah, that's a good way to put it.
Do you want a fun Tony that you got from Iron-man 1-3? Here it is. You even get some good interaction with him doubting himself, or scared, and to me that's always the most interesting side of Tony. Also, Doctor Doom is creepy as fuck in here. Oh and the "Bearded Bro" moments got me. I did have fun reading most of this tbh, and if you like Tony at all I'm sure you'll enjoy it too. The main plot is silly, dumb, but it works to give our characters some great interactions. The last issue was a letdown to the first arc but I'll keep checking this one out.
